                                  Opera free VPN provides these options: Optimal location (default), the Americas, Europe and Asia.

                                  Unfortunately the option for the "Asia" do not work as it should work.
                                  When I choose "Asia" location, it connects to a Germany IP adress (so an Europe country and not an Asia country): https://i.imgur.com/2uMWgVw.png

                                  Optimal location works great: https://i.imgur.com/QbX5rbP.png
                                  Americas works great: https://i.imgur.com/McD56sZ.png
                                  Europe works great: https://i.imgur.com/ZNbYHgU.png

                                  And please increase the bandwidth of Opera's VPN servers. Previously, when supplied by SurfEasy LLC the bandwidth was much faster (and better)!

                                  Specs: Opera 50.0.2762.58 stable in a Windows 10 Pro computer
